71 COUPLING DEVICE IN OVERHEAD CONVEYOR SYSTEM EP03728200.1 2003-05-22 EP1549575A1 2005-07-06 JOHANSSON, Hardy; JOHANSSON, Palle
A device for an overhead conveyor system of the type where a plurality of carriages (7) by contracting a rotating drive shaft (5) are propellable along a rail (2). The device comprises an operating arm (28) arranged in connection with a first carriage (7b) and adapted to actuate, by turning about an axis of rotation (26), a power transmission element (24) to disconnect the carriage from contact with the drive shaft, and an angled supporting surface (20) arranged in connection with a second carriage (7a). One end of the operating arm (28) is further adapted, when said carriages (7a, 7b) are moved towards each other, to contact said angled supporting surface (20) and be moved along the same, so that the operating arm (28) thus performs a turning motion and disconnects said first carriage (7b). According to the invention, the drive of the carriage will thus be interrupted as soon as its operating arm is contacted with the supporting surface of an anteriorly situated carriage. In this manner, carriages can be buffered.

The invention relates to a suspended conveyor device, wherein the conveying supports (1) for the goods to be transported supports itself on runners (9) on guide rails (3) so that it can be displaced along the conveyor path. Driver elements (17), especially brush elements (17) are disposed on a drag chain/drive chain (15) that is guided along the conveyor path. Said driver elements can be displaced between a driving position and a non-driving position. The invention provides for various designs for transferring the driver elements (17) to the non-driving position in the event of a jam of conveying supports (1) so that they do not or only slightly impinge upon the jammed conveying supports (1). In the driving position, the driver elements (17) impinge upon the conveying supports (1) so as to drive them along the conveyor path.
76 POWER AND FREE CONVEYOR SYSTEM EP95929535.3 1995-08-14 EP0820397B1 2003-02-26 DESILETS, Dennis, W.; CARLSON, Raymond, L.; DALE, Steven, J.
A power and free conveyor system (30) is provided which utilizes a difference in height between the wipe in power trolley track (41A) and the wipe out power trolley track (41B), with or without a camming down of a retractable wide dog (84) of the free trolley (50), to allow the wipe in power chain (40A) to wipe in over the retractable dog (84) without any possibility of lateral interference. Thereafter the elevation of the wipe in power trolley track (41A) and the wipe out power trolley track (41B) are the same. An improved stop device (170) operating to push down the retractable dog (84) from the power chain (40) is also provided.

80 SUSPENSION CONVEYOR INSTALLATION EP95924238.9 1995-06-14 EP0764101B1 1998-09-23 ENDERLEIN, Robby; ROBU, Johann; GEIGER, Hansjörg
A suspension conveyor installation comprising roller devices (4) individually displaceable on a rail system, and a drive chain (16) routed above said rail system, the bottom side of the drive chain (16) having driver elements (13) for engaging respective drive receiving elements (11) arranged on the top faces of the roller devices (4). The driver elements (13) are arranged as driver plates in the form of link plates mounted to the drive chain (16) such as to be collectively displaceable vertically upwards toward the drive chain (16), with the links (14) of the link plates being pivotable with respect to each other about vertical axes perpendicular to the drive chain (16). The bottom edge of each driver element (13) comprises: an oblique lifting ramp (18), arranged at the leading end of the driver element (13) and descending against the conveying direction, for lifting the driver element (13) upon abutment; a glider surface (19, 25, 41), adjoining the lifting ramp (18, 39) and extending in the conveying direction, for maintaining the driver element (13) lifted; and a driver recess (20, 37), adjoining the glider surface (19, 25, 41), for receiving the drive receiving element (11) of the respective roller device (4); such that the disengaged position is established or maintained, respectively, by the lifting ramp (18, 39) abutting onto an obstacle or an adjacent roller device (4), and by the glider surface (19, 25, 41) gliding on said obstacle or on the top end of an adjacent roller device (4).
